MSPCA Angell Reviews FAQs

MSPCA Angell has an overall rating of 3.5 out of 5, based on over 84 reviews left anonymously by employees. 58% of employees would recommend working at MSPCA Angell to a friend and 53% have a positive outlook for the business. This rating has decreased by -3% over the last 12 months.

According to anonymously submitted Glassdoor reviews, MSPCA Angell employees rate their compensation and benefits as 3.5 out of 5. Find out more about salaries and benefits at MSPCA Angell. This rating has been stable over the past 12 months.

58% of MSPCA Angell employees would recommend working there to a friend based on Glassdoor reviews. Employees also rated MSPCA Angell 2.6 out of 5 for work life balance, 3.7 for culture and values and 3.8 for career opportunities.

According to reviews on Glassdoor, employees commonly mention the pros of working at MSPCA Angell to be career development, benefits, coworkers and the cons to be senior leadership, culture, management.
